> > > Testcase:
> > > 1. create a minix file system and mount it
> > > 2. open a file on the file system with O_RDWR|O_CREAT|O_TRUNC|O_DIRECT
> > > 3. open fails with -EINVAL but leaves an empty file behind. All other
> > > open() failures don't leave the failed open files behind.
> > >
> > > It is hard to check the direct_IO op before creating the inode. Just as
> > > ext4 and btrfs do, this patch will resolve the issue by allowing to
> > > create the file with O_DIRECT but returning error when writing the file.
